Overview

Art demands sacrifice. But how much blood is too much? Detective Maya Chen thought she'd seen every kind of murder Seattle had to offer. She was wrong. The body hangs suspended in a waterfront loft, surrounded by mirrors and flickering projections-a grotesque recreation of a performance art piece so disturbing it was banned decades ago. The victim: a whistleblower about to expose a multi-million dollar fraud in the city's elite digital art world. But this isn't just murder. It's a masterpiece. As more bodies appear-each staged with chilling precision, each mimicking infamous artworks that destroyed careers and shattered lives-Maya realizes she's hunting an artist who sees death as the ultimate medium. Someone who believes that to make the world see the truth, you must paint it in blood. The deeper Maya digs into Seattle's glittering art scene, the more the lines blur between creation and destruction, between genius and madness. Gallery owners. Billionaire collectors. Museum directors. They all have secrets worth killing for. And they're all connected to a shadowy consortium that decides which artists succeed-and which ones disappear. But the killer isn't finished. And the final installation has already begun. When Maya discovers a devastating connection between the murders and her sister's suicide two years ago, she realizes the truth: she was never just investigating this case. She was always meant to be part of it. Now, as the killer's endgame unfolds at a sold-out gallery opening, Maya must confront a terrible question: What happens when the detective becomes the art? When the witness becomes the witnessed? When justice demands she sacrifice everything-including herself? In a world where art is currency and visibility is power, some people will do anything to be seen. Even if it means making everyone else disappear. The exhibition opens at midnight. And Maya Chen is the final piece.
